WebJul 1, 2024 · The 20-week pregnancy scan can be performed between 18 and 20+6 weeks of pregnancy and is often known as the anomaly scan. The scan is performed to identify : The bones of all four limbs and fingers/toes. All four chambers of the heart. Structure of the brain. Their spinal cord. Their face, nasal bone and mouth (checking for cleft lip). WebBetween 18 and 21 weeks, you’ll have your anomaly scan, which is sometimes called a mid-pregnancy scan. This is also done on the NHS as a black-and-white 2D scan. The sonographer will take a detailed look at your baby’s heart, brain, bones, spinal cord, face, kidneys and abdomen to check for a range of conditions.

WebMar 9, 2024 · Healthcare Bluebook, which estimates fair prices of medical procedures in various parts of the country, suggests that a reasonable cost for a fetal ultrasound is $202. This amount may vary, depending on the city or state of the mother. According to Healthcare Bluebook, a fetal ultrasound in New Jersey could cost around $350 but in Oklahoma, it ...
WebThe "sticker price" of having an ultrasound can vary dramatically, depending on where you live, and who’s providing the service.
